Description
Tillandsia ariza-juliae is a distinctive epiphytic plant species belonging to the Bromeliaceae family. Within the context of specialized plant cultivation, this species is highly regarded for its unique physiological adaptations, which allow it to thrive in environments where traditional soil-based nutrient uptake is not required.
The native distribution of this plant is restricted to the Dominican Republic. It naturally inhabits mountain regions where high atmospheric moisture and specialized light conditions characterize its ecological niche. Understanding this origin is critical for successful cultivation, as the plant remains sensitive to deviations from its natural climate parameters.
Botanically, the plant displays a dense rosette structure composed of specialized, trichome-covered leaves. These trichomes are evolutionary adaptations that enable the plant to efficiently harvest moisture and airborne nutrients. The reproductive cycle involves the formation of a decorative inflorescence, which is a key trait for taxonomical identification and aesthetic appreciation.
The agronomic requirements for Tillandsia ariza-juliae involve specific management practices to ensure longevity:
- Maintained high humidity levels via periodic misting.
- Effective air circulation to prevent moisture stagnation.
- Indirect, bright light exposure for optimal photosynthetic activity.
- Utilization of specialized epiphytic mounts rather than potting soil.
Economically, this species serves the ornamental horticulture sector, frequently appearing in botanical collections and specialized interior design projects. Common phytosanitary challenges include susceptibility to fungal infections triggered by excessive moisture accumulation within the leaf rosette. Pests such as mealybugs and scale insects may also pose risks, necessitating consistent monitoring and the application of appropriate biological or chemical control measures.
